Type-Bulbs Pollinator Magnets
Bees and butterflies need all the help they can get, and planting the right bulbs is one way to support them. Bulbs like crocus, bluebells, and snowdrops provide an early nectar source, keeping pollinators happy and your garden buzzing. Want to be the talk of the bee community? These bulbs are your golden ticket.

Type-Bulbs Shade Dwellers
Not all gardens are sun-drenched, and that’s where shade-loving bulbs shine—literally. Bulbs like snowdrops, trout lilies, and wood hyacinths flourish in low-light areas, proving that beauty isn’t just for the sun-lovers.

Type-Bulbs Edible Delights
Some bulbs don’t just look good—they taste amazing too! Onions, garlic, and shallots are part of the bulb family, adding flavor and health benefits to your kitchen. Easy to grow and even easier to cook with, these edible bulbs prove that gardening is deliciously rewarding.
